The sanctuary where we gather to worship at Hope Lowertown is adorned with stained glass windows that are not only beautiful but significant. These majestic windows represent important truths about the Christian faith that help us to better understand our gospel, our history, and our place in God’s story of redemption. This series looks at these windows and considers their background, meaning, importance and impact for us today as followers of Jesus.
